Testing with artificial intelligence
Artificial intelligence has long since found its way into the field of software testing, from automated test case creation to intelligent error detection. AI-powered tools can recognize patterns in code changes, dynamically adapt tests, and even identify potential vulnerabilities before a test is first run. The result: faster test cycles, earlier error detection, and more efficient quality assurance.
But to fully exploit this potential, more than just the use of modern tools is needed. The basis for reliable AI-supported testing is high-quality, representative data. Poor or incomplete data sets lead to inaccurate predictions and undermine confidence in the results. Equally important is a solid understanding of the underlying AI concepts: only those who understand how the algorithms work can make targeted use of their strengths and circumvent their weaknesses.
Used correctly, AI becomes a powerful partner. It takes on repetitive, time-consuming tasks and gives the team the opportunity to focus on creative and complex test cases.
So, those who integrate AI into the testing process while investing in data quality and expertise lay the foundation for a new level of testing efficiency and raise software quality to a whole new level.
